Isaiah Campbell is offered by Rutgers football this week

Rutgers football is now the sixth Power Five offer for Isaiah Campbell, a defensive lineman from North Carolina. The Scarlet Knights offered the standout this week, becoming his first Big Ten offer.

A class of 2025 recruit, Campbell is coming off a strong season for Greene Central (Snow Hill, NC). The 6-foot-4, 265-pound defensive tackle had 61 total tackles, five sacks and two fumble recoveries as the Rams finished the season 10-2.

In addition to football, Campbell also plays basketball and runs track.

He held previous offers from Duke, North Carolina, North Carolina State, South Carolina and Virginia. His most recent offer came from Virginia in mid-March. Last week, he visited South Carolina.
